The U16M4HT servo motor delivers peak torque of 5242 oz-in and operates at a rated terminal voltage of 125.7 volts. Manufactured by Kollmorgen and part of the ServoDisc Pancake DC Motors, it has a maximum recommended speed of 6000 RPM. It provides a rated power output of 890 Watts with a torque constant of 52.77 oz-in/Amp.

Product Description:
The Kollmorgen U16M4HT motor is different from standard servomotors because of its ironless disc armature with a unique internal construction. This motor has large torsional stiffness. The product has an exceptionally compact design. This device can reach a speed of 0 RPM to 3000 RPM with just 60 degrees of rotation. The unit has no arcing because there is no iron in its armature. Its small and light aperture makes it less heavy than standard servomotors. This motor portrays a short cycle time along with more moves per second.
The product is ideal for applications that require smooth and precise speed control. This device helps in meeting the increasing demand for business automation requirements. The unit has full torque from 0 to full speed. It portrays an ultra-smooth rotation at any speed. This motor has a round frame. The product faces axial and radial phases when it is in the operation phase. This device is integrated with a tachometer to support its operation. The unit weighs 8.5 kg and is only 3.03 mm long. Its magnetic field is aligned axially and parallel to its shaft.
This motor delivers the desired torque very fast with its very low electrical time constant. The product portrays a low close physical coupling. This device depicts a long brush life because of the elimination of arcing. The unit owes its flat-disc configuration to the copper conductor layers in its armature. It is ideal for deployment in robot axis drives because of the compact size and high torque combination. This motor has its magnets positioned on the end plates resulting in an axial magnetic field and a small air gap between the magnets.
Frequently Asked Questions about U16M4HT:
Q: How long does take for the current to flow into the armature of the U16M4HT motor?
A: It takes less than a millisecond for the current to flow into the armature of the U16M4HT motor.
Q: Why is there very less inductance in the U16M4HT motor?
A: There is very less inductance in the U16M4HT motor because there is no iron in the armature.
Q: What factors contribute to the mechanical design of the U16M4HT motor?
A: Large torsional stiffness and close physical coupling contribute to the mechanical design of the U16M4HT motor.
Q: What is the moment of inertia of the U16M4HT motor?
A: The moment of inertia of the U16M4HT motor is 7.91 kgcm².
Q: What is the average friction torque of the U16M4HT motor?
A: The average friction torque of the U16M4HT motor is 7.4 N-cm.
